// Constants for Fixtureforge, our test-data factory library.
// Reviewer notes: generated records are deterministic per seed, so
// changing any constant below invalidates recorded snapshots and
// forces a regeneration pass across dependent suites. Collection
// sizes are intentionally small to keep CI under budget; the large
// variants live behind the stress profile. Keep referential depth
// capped or the graph builder recurses badly on cyclic schemas.
// The current defaults, used by every factory unless overridden, are:

constants for hahig-hahag:
TIERS = {
    "gorwyn": 183,
    "gorir": 689,
    "wenir": 585,
    "fraiel": 643,
    "sordor": 38,
    "fenmir": 251,
    "jorax": 1020,
}

Runbook bit: account recovery — Siftcache bloom layer

Hey RM — quick one. Siftcache sits as a bloom filter in front of the Kervo key-value store; if its service account gets locked (usually after a botched credential rotation), reads fall through and Kervo gets hammered. Don't panic, the store holds. Recover via the ops console: unlock the account, then trigger a filter rebuild and watch false-positive rates settle. The unlock screen asks for the passphrase below.

unlock words, bagug-bafop: julwyn-belox-kasvan-zorath-tamax-praiel

TURN-208: Gatevale turnstile counters at the Merrow Field pilot double-count when a rotation reverses mid-cycle. Attendance totals drift roughly 2% high per event. The debounce window fix is implemented, reviewed by Ilsa, and soak-tested across two simulated match days without drift. Ready for your cut; the candidate build is identified below.

trace token, tagag-tafog: htk6_5ed18c